To be eligible for Equity Release you need to meet the following criteria:
● Be 55 years old or over (The youngest homeowner needs to be over 55)
● Own you home (This can be with a mortgage or previous loans against the property, but these must
be paid off with the money you receive)
● Property value over £70,000

We then work with:
● The lender who will provide the product most suited to you, who will appoint a valuer to work out the value of your property.
● The valuer is independent from the lender, they will value your house fairly compared to the current property market.
● Lenders will appoint a law firm, where a solicitor or conveyancer will make sure all the paperwork is completed correctly.
● Lastly, an independent solicitor will be appointed to work with you, to make sure you fully understand your rights and that the paperwork has been completed correctly.
